WebThe discrete Fourier transform maps an n -tuple of elements of to another n -tuple of elements of according to the following formula: By convention, the tuple is said to be in the time domain and the index is called time. The tuple is said to be in the frequency domain and the index is called frequency. The tuple is also called the spectrum of .
